Review of Phantom Thread (2017) by Daniel R — 29 Jan 2018
One thing I will say about this film that I have never said before is that I am certain I would have liked it more if it would have had no dialogue. As I mentioned before, this film masterfully portrayed a void that existed in the relationships through the heavy silence that often consumed scenes.
There was much more said by the facial expressions and looks that the characters showed as they observed and reacted to each other. While the dialogue wasn't the worst, it felt in the way at times of the silent communication.
Had it been just the beautiful music and stunning visuals, I would have enjoyed this film much more.
